Merge "Fix incorrect usages of fake moref in VMware tests"
This commit is contained in:
@@ -112,7 +112,7 @@ class ImageCacheManagerTestCase(test.NoDBTestCase):
|
||||
def test_get_ds_browser(self):
|
||||
cache = self._imagecache._ds_browser
|
||||
ds_browser = mock.Mock()
|
||||
moref = fake.ManagedObjectReference('datastore-100')
|
||||
moref = fake.ManagedObjectReference(value='datastore-100')
|
||||
self.assertIsNone(cache.get(moref.value))
|
||||
mock_get_method = mock.Mock(return_value=ds_browser)
|
||||
with mock.patch.object(vutil, 'get_object_property', mock_get_method):
|
||||
@@ -136,7 +136,7 @@ class ImageCacheManagerTestCase(test.NoDBTestCase):
|
||||
mock.patch.object(ds_util, 'get_sub_folders',
|
||||
fake_get_sub_folders)
|
||||
) as (_get_dynamic, _get_sub_folders):
|
||||
fake_ds_ref = fake.ManagedObjectReference('fake-ds-ref')
|
||||
fake_ds_ref = fake.ManagedObjectReference(value='fake-ds-ref')
|
||||
datastore = ds_obj.Datastore(name='ds', ref=fake_ds_ref)
|
||||
ds_path = datastore.build_path('base_folder')
|
||||
images = self._imagecache._list_datastore_images(
|
||||
|
||||
@@ -55,12 +55,12 @@ class VMwareVMUtilTestCase(test.NoDBTestCase):
|
||||
|
||||
def _test_get_stats_from_cluster(self, connection_state="connected",
|
||||
maintenance_mode=False):
|
||||
ManagedObjectRefs = [fake.ManagedObjectReference("host1",
|
||||
"HostSystem"),
|
||||
fake.ManagedObjectReference("host2",
|
||||
"HostSystem")]
|
||||
ManagedObjectRefs = [fake.ManagedObjectReference("HostSystem",
|
||||
"host1"),
|
||||
fake.ManagedObjectReference("HostSystem",
|
||||
"host2")]
|
||||
hosts = fake._convert_to_array_of_mor(ManagedObjectRefs)
|
||||
respool = fake.ManagedObjectReference("resgroup-11", "ResourcePool")
|
||||
respool = fake.ManagedObjectReference("ResourcePool", "resgroup-11")
|
||||
prop_dict = {'host': hosts, 'resourcePool': respool}
|
||||
|
||||
hardware = fake.DataObject()
|
||||
|
||||
@@ -72,7 +72,7 @@ class VMwareVMOpsTestCase(test.NoDBTestCase):
|
||||
|
||||
self._virtapi = mock.Mock()
|
||||
self._image_id = nova.tests.unit.image.fake.get_valid_image_id()
|
||||
fake_ds_ref = vmwareapi_fake.ManagedObjectReference('fake-ds')
|
||||
fake_ds_ref = vmwareapi_fake.ManagedObjectReference(value='fake-ds')
|
||||
self._ds = ds_obj.Datastore(
|
||||
ref=fake_ds_ref, name='fake_ds',
|
||||
capacity=10 * units.Gi,
|
||||
@@ -1382,7 +1382,7 @@ class VMwareVMOpsTestCase(test.NoDBTestCase):
|
||||
def test_get_ds_browser(self):
|
||||
cache = self._vmops._datastore_browser_mapping
|
||||
ds_browser = mock.Mock()
|
||||
moref = vmwareapi_fake.ManagedObjectReference('datastore-100')
|
||||
moref = vmwareapi_fake.ManagedObjectReference(value='datastore-100')
|
||||
self.assertIsNone(cache.get(moref.value))
|
||||
mock_call_method = mock.Mock(return_value=ds_browser)
|
||||
with mock.patch.object(self._session, '_call_method',
|
||||
|
||||
Reference in New Issue
Block a user